Bori is a Rural village located in Shrigonda, Ahmednagar, Maharashtra.
The total population of Bori is 1,567.
Bori village comprises 309 households.
The literacy rate in Bori is 73%. Among the literate population of 1,011, there are 585 literate males and 426 literate females.
In Bori, there are 820 males and 747 females, with a sex ratio of 911 females per 1000 males.
There are 183 children (11.7% of population), comprising 95 boys and 88 girls.
The total number of workers in Bori is 966, with 930 main workers and 36 marginal workers.
In Bori, there are 171 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(95 males, 76 females) and 4 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(2 males, 2 females).
Bori is located in Maharashtra state, Ahmednagar district, and falls under Shrigonda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 558482 and LGD code is 558482.
